Location and Accessibility

Round Rock Dog Depot is conveniently located at 800 Deerfoot Dr, Round Rock, TX 78664, USA. This prime address places it within the heart of Round Rock, making it easily accessible for residents throughout the city and neighboring communities like Pflugerville, Hutto, and North Austin. The park is situated behind the Lake Creek Pool, offering a clear landmark for navigation.

The accessibility of the Round Rock Dog Depot is one of its strong suits. Being a municipal park managed by the City of Round Rock Parks and Recreation Department, it is designed for public convenience. While specific parking instructions aren't always explicitly detailed in reviews, public city parks typically offer ample parking spaces nearby. The park is fully fenced with double-gated entrances, ensuring a secure transition for dogs entering and exiting the off-leash areas. Furthermore, the park is noted as being wheelchair accessible, ensuring that dog lovers of all abilities can enjoy the space with their pets. Its location within a well-established area of Round Rock means it’s easily reachable via main roads, making it a hassle-free destination for a fun outing with your dog. The park operates seasonally with consistent hours: from April 1 to October 1, it's open from 6 a.m. to 8 p.m., and from October 2 to March 31, hours are 6 a.m. to 6 p.m.

Promotions or Special Offers

As a public park managed by the City of Round Rock Parks and Recreation Department, Round Rock Dog Depot does not typically offer traditional commercial promotions or special offers, such as discounts or loyalty programs. Access to the park is generally free for the public, serving as a community amenity.

However, the City of Round Rock Parks and Recreation Department frequently hosts various community events throughout the year, some of which are pet-friendly or held at or near the Dog Depot. For instance, Round Rock has hosted "Bark in the Park" events with the Round Rock Express baseball team, allowing dogs at specific games. In the past, there have also been Halloween-themed dog festivals like the "BARKtacular HOWLoween Dog Festival" held at the Dog Depot itself.

I have been here multiple times with my dog. Plenty of free parking and paved walkways to the dog exercise areas are available. There is a small-dog-only area, plus two separate large dog areas. Water is provided / available in several spots. Seating for humans is provided in the form of benches and picnic tables and some shelter/ shade. Doggie bags and trash cans are included. Beware that the areas are muddy if there were recent rains. In addition, volleyball courts, basketball courts, a playscape, picnic pavilion and public restroom and water fountain are also available for use.
